Steamed Crab with Tomato and Dal Rasam

Steamed crab served with flavour-infused rasam and crisp appalam.

Ingredients

  • 1 kg small live crabs (200-300 g each)

    4 Tbsp toor dal

    2 Tbsp refined oil

    1 tsp cumin seeds

    2 tsp ginger, chopped

    1 tsp garlic, peeled

    2 green chillies

    1 cup tomato, chopped

    Salt to taste

    1 tsp black pepper

    2 Tbsp tamarind pulp

    1 Tbsp rasam powder

    1 Tbsp desi ghee

    1 tsp mustard seeds

    1 tsp urad dal, washed

    1 tsp curry leaves

    1 pinch asafetida

    2 Tbsp fresh coriander

    Few appalams (optional)

    Oil for drying

Method

Wash and steam crab in combi oven or boiling water till done.

Wash, drain and cook toor dal in a vessel with lots of water until soft. Mash dal with a ladle.

Take oil in a non stick pan. Add cumin seeds and allow it to crackle. Add chopped ginger, garlic and green chilli. Saute for a minute.

Now add chopped tomato, salt, black pepper, tamarind pulp and rasam powder.

Add 750 ml water to tomato masala. Simmer for a few minutes.

Add dal water and simmer. Adjust the seasoning.

Take desi ghee in a small pan and make a south Indian tempering with mustard seeds, urad dal, curry leaves and asafetida.

Add the tempering in rasam and finish it with chopped coriander.

Fry the appalam until crisp and serve along with steamed crab and tomato rasam.
